S.Res. 516Passed Senate

A resolution ensuring that the adoption and foster care system in the United States is child-centered and compassionate and that young people aging out of foster care are provided with adequate support and resources to transition successfully to independent adulthood.

Introduced: Nov 20, 2025

Latest action date: Dec 3, 2025

Latest development

Resolution agreed to in Senate without amendment and with a preamble by Unanimous Consent. (consideration: CR S8487)
